These delivery issues had the potential to cause delays in communicating critical information to fi rst responders and they highlighted problems in the current dispatch system. It was determined that with 250 – 300 callouts per day, the CAD could not meet current capacity demand. Toms River needed a completely new solution. SOLUTION A nine-member committee was formed to study the public safety communications needs of Toms River and surrounding communities.
